Cost of Living Calculator - Newton, Texas vs San Augustine, Texas


The cost of living in San Augustine, Texas is 1.7% more expensive than Newton, Texas.

You would need a salary of $20,344 in San Augustine, Texas to maintain the standard of living you have in Newton, Texas.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, San Augustine, Texas is more expensive than Newton, Texas
• Health is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
